SPANISH CHICKEN WITH CHORIZO, POTATOES & CHICKPEAS



Spanish chicken with chorizo, potatoes & chickpeas image

Give Sunday lunch a twist with this hearty one-pot roast with sweet paprika, garlic and saffron - serve with crusty bread to mop up the juices

2 lemons , 1 zested and halved, the other cut into wedges
1⅓ - 1.5kg whole chicken
1 tbsp sweet paprika , plus a couple of pinches
3 tbsp olive oil
850g potatoes , cut into chunks
220g chorizo ring, cut into chunks
1 whole garlic bulb , cloves peeled
glass of white wine , about 200ml
200ml hot chicken stock
2 pinches of saffron
2 x 400g cans chickpeas , drained and rinsed
small pack parsley , roughly chopped
300g Greek yogurt
crusty bread , to serve (optional)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Insert the zested, halved lemon into the chicken cavity, and mix the 1 tbsp paprika with 1 tbsp of the oil and some seasoning. Rub this all over the chicken and sit it in the middle of a big roasting tin. Toss the potatoes and chorizo with the rest of the oil and scatter around the chicken. Cover everything with a big tent of foil and roast for 30 mins.
  • Remove the foil from the tin, baste the chicken, then stir the lemon wedges and garlic cloves into the spuds and chorizo. Roast uncovered for another 30 mins while you mix the wine, stock and 1 pinch of saffron together.
  • Pour the stock mixture into the tin with the chickpeas and some seasoning, stirring together with the potato and chorizo, then put back in the oven for a final 30 mins.
  • Check the chicken is cooked through, then stir the parsley into the tin. Mix the lemon zest, another pinch of saffron and 1-2 pinches of paprika into the yogurt and serve alongside.

EASY CHICKEN, CHORIZO AND CHICKPEA STEW

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 red onion (diced)
1 red pepper (diced)
130 g diced chorizo ((you should be able to buy it ready-diced, which saves a lot of time!))
3 cloves garlic (crushed or grated)
1 teaspoon dried chilli flakes
3 teaspoons smoked paprika
400 g tin chopped tomatoes
400 g tin chickpeas ((including the liquid))
1 chicken stock cube ((I use Kallo Organic))
400 g skinless, boneless chicken thigh fillets (diced)
Black pepper to taste ((I usually find there's no need to add salt as the stock cube is salty enough))
Brown rice, white rice, mashed potatoes, pasta or crusty white bread
Greens or any green vegetable of your choice, such as cabbage, green beans, kale, cavalo nero, broccoli, peas...

Steps:

  • Place the oil, onion and pepper in a wide and fairly deep saucepan. Fry over a low heat, with the lid on, for 3-5 minutes, until the onions and peppers have softened. Stir occasionally.
  • Add the chorizo and cook for 1 more minute with the lid off. Stir occasionally.
  • Add the garlic, chilli flakes and smoked paprika. Cook for 1 more minute with the lid off. Stir occasionally.
  • Tip in the tomatoes and chickpeas. Then add the diced chicken, stock cube and black pepper. Bring to the boil, then turn down low and simmer for 15 minutes with the lid off, until the chicken is cooked through and the sauce has thickened. Stir occasionally.
  • Serve with brown rice, greens and a glass of Rioja... or whatever accompaniments you prefer!

RED WINE-BRAISED CHICKEN WITH CHORIZO AND CHICKPEAS



Red Wine-Braised Chicken with Chorizo and Chickpeas image

Crispy bits of chorizo, tender chickpeas, and a splash of Sherry vinegar give this simple weeknight braise a decidedly Spanish vibe and hearty bite.

1/2 cup golden raisins
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
2 teaspoons kosher salt, divided
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per, plus more
8 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s (about 2 1/2 pounds), trimmed
1 teaspoon olive oil
6 ounces dried Spanish chorizo, casing removed, halved lengthwise, sliced into 1/4-inch-thick half-moons
1 (15.5-ounce) can chickpeas, rinsed, drained
1 teaspoon finely grated orange zest
1 small onion, thinly sliced
1/2 cup dry red wine
1/2 cup low-sodium chicken broth
1/2 teaspoon Sherry vinegar
1/3 cup plus 1 tablespoon coarsely chopped flat-leaf parsley, divided

Steps:

  • Place raisins in a small bowl; cover with hot water. Set aside.
  • Mix cumin, paprika, 1 1/4 tsp. salt, and 1/4 tsp. cayenne in another small bowl. Pat chicken dry and rub all over with spice mixture.
  • Heat oil in a 5-7-qt. Dutch oven or large wide saucepan over medium-high. Add chorizo and cook, stirring frequently, until crisp, 5-8 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, mix chickpeas, orange zest, remaining 3/4 tsp. salt, and a pinch of cayenne in a medium bowl.
  • Using a slotted spoon, transfer chorizo to chickpea mixture; stir to combine. Drain all but 2 Tbsp. fat from pan, then return to medium-high heat. Cook chicken, skin side down, until well-browned, 12-14 minutes. Transfer to a plate skin side up. Add onion to pan and cook, stirring occasionally, until just tender, about 3 minutes.
  • Add wine and broth. Bring to a boil, nestle chicken skin side up into onions in pan. Lower heat to medium, cover, and cook until chicken is cooked through, about 10 minutes. Meanwhile, drain raisins and stir into chorizo mixture.
  • Stir chorizo mixture and Sherry vinegar into chicken mixture. Cook, uncovered, until heated through, about 1 minute. Stir in 1/3 cup parsley, then divide among 4 plates. Top with remaining 1 Tbsp. parsley and serve.

GARBANZOS AND GREENS WITH CHORIZO

1 cup dried chickpeas (garbanzo beans)
1/2 onion, stuck with a clove
1 small carrot, peeled, cut in 2-inch chunks
1 small bay leaf
Salt
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 large onion, finely diced (about 1 cup)
Salt and pepper
6 ounces Spanish chorizo, diced
2 teaspoons minced garlic
1/4 teaspoon pimentón
1 teaspoon cumin seeds, lightly toasted and coarsely ground
1 pound kale or chard, washed and cut in wide ribbons
1/4 cup pine nuts, lightly toasted, optional

Steps:

  • Pick over chickpeas, put them in a large bowl and cover with cold water. Soak for at least 8 hours, preferably overnight.
  • Drain chickpeas (they should have swelled considerably) and put them in a soup pot. Cover with 6 cups water, add the onion stuck with clove, the carrot and the bay leaf. Bring to a boil over high heat, then lower heat and let chickpeas simmer gently. Skim any foam that rises to the surface. Cook for 1 to 1 1/2 hours until chickpeas are tender. (If chickpeas seem to be drying out during cooking, add 1/2 cup water to keep them submerged in liquid.) Season generously with salt, and leave chickpeas to cool in the broth (cooking liquid). You should have about 2 1/2 cups cooked chickpeas. (They may be cooked a day in advance, if desired.)
  • Put olive oil in a deep, wide skillet over medium-high heat. Add the diced onion, season with salt and pepper, and cook, stirring occasionally, until softened and l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Add the chorizo and let it fry a bit, then turn heat to medium. Add the garlic, pimentón and 1/2 teaspoon of the cumin, and stir to coat. Add the cooked chickpeas and 1/2 cup broth. Bring to a simmer, add the greens and sprinkle with a little salt. Stir to allow the greens to wilt. Put on the lid and cook for 4 to 5 minutes, until greens are completely cooked. Stir well, ta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. To serve as a tapa or side dish, transfer to a cazuela or deep serving platter. Sprinkle with the remaining 1/2 teaspoon cumin and the pine nuts, if using. Alternatively, to serve as soup, spoon the garbanzo-and-greens mixture into 4 deep soup bowls. Ladle 1 cup heated broth into each bowl, and sprinkle soup with the remaining cumin.

ROAST CHICKEN BREASTS WITH GARBANZO BEANS, TOMATOES, AND PAPRIKA



Roast Chicken Breasts with Garbanzo Beans, Tomatoes, and Paprika image

Use leftovers for sandwiches the next day: Place shredded chicken, garbanzos, and tomatoes in a pita bread and top with the yogurt sauce.

1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
4 garlic cloves, pressed
1 tablespoon smoked paprika*
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on dried crushed red pepper
1/2 cup plain yogurt or Greek yogurt
4 chicken breast halves with bones
1 15-ounce can garbanzo beans (chickpeas), drained
1 12-ounce container cherry tomatoes
1 cup chopped fresh cilantro,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450°. Mix first 5 ingredients in medium bowl. Pour 1 teaspoon spiced oil mixture into small bowl; whisk in yogurt and set aside for sauce. Place chicken on large rimmed baking sheet. Rub 2 tablespoons spiced oil mixture over chicken. Add beans, tomatoes, and 1/2 cup cilantro to remaining spiced oil mixture; toss to coat. Pour bean mixture around chicken. Sprinkle everything generously with salt and pepper.
  • Roast until chicken is cooked through, about 20 minutes. Sprinkle with 1/2 cup cilantro. Transfer chicken to plates. Spoon bean mixture over. Serve with yogurt sauce.
  • *Sometimes labeled Pimentón Dulce or Pimentón de La Vera Dulce; available at some supermarkets, at specialty foods stores, and from tienda.com.

GARBANZOS Y CHORIZO

2 tablespoons olive oil
1 small yellow onion, thinly sliced
20 ounces garbanzo beans, drained (in jar or can)
1/2 lb sliced chorizo sausage
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• In a large saute pan, heat olive oil and saute onion until golden.
  • Add sliced chorizo and cook, stirring frequently to release the flavors, for approximately 1 minute.
  • Add the beans and cook another 5 minutes.
  • Season with salt and pepper.
